What Are Purchase Loans?
A purchase loan, commonly known as a home buying loan, is a mortgage specifically designed to finance the acquisition of a new property. Unlike refinancing or other loan types, purchase loans cater to individuals or families aiming to buy a primary residence, vacation home, or investment property. These loans come in various forms, including conventional loans, FHA loans, VA loans, and USDA loans, each offering unique benefits and eligibility requirements tailored to different financial situations.

Conventional Loans
Conventional loans are the most widely used mortgage type and are not government-backed. They often require a higher credit score and a larger down payment but offer flexible terms and lower overall costs for borrowers with strong credit. FHA Loans
Federal Housing Administration (FHA) loans are government-backed and ideal for first-time homebuyers or those with lower credit scores or limited down payment funds. Requiring as little as 3.5% down, FHA loans have more lenient credit criteria, making them accessible for many in Tehama County. VA Loans
VA loans are available to eligible veterans, active-duty service members, and certain military spouses. Backed by the Department of Veterans Affairs, these loans often require no down payment or private mortgage insurance (PMI), offering significant savings. USDA Loans
USDA loans, also government-backed, promote homeownership in rural and suburban areas. Offering no down payment and low interest rates, they are perfect for eligible buyers in rural parts of Tehama County, such as areas outside Red Bluff and Corning. Why Homeownership in Tehama County, California?
Tehama County, located in Northern California, offers a compelling mix of affordability, natural beauty, and community charm, making it an excellent place to invest in a home. Here are some reasons why securing a purchase loan in this area is a wise decision, backed by local insights and data:
- Affordable Housing Market: Compared to California’s urban centers like San Francisco or Los Angeles, Tehama County offers more affordable housing options. According to the California Association of Realtors, the median home price in Tehama County as of 2023 is significantly lower than the state average, often below $300,000 in areas like Red Bluff and Corning. This affordability makes it an attractive destination for first-time buyers and families.
- Scenic Beauty and Outdoor Recreation: Tehama County is a gateway to stunning natural attractions. The Sacramento River runs through the county, offering opportunities for fishing, boating, and riverside living. Proximity to Lassen Volcanic National Park provides residents with hiking, camping, and breathtaking views, ideal for those seeking a nature-centric lifestyle.
- Strong Community and Economy: With a population of around 65,000, Tehama County fosters a close-knit community vibe. Major towns like Red Bluff, known as the “Victorian City on the River,” host events such as the annual Red Bluff Round-Up rodeo, drawing visitors and boosting local pride. The county’s economy is supported by agriculture, including olive and walnut production, as well as growing sectors in retail and healthcare, providing stable job opportunities.
- Growth Potential: While still rural, Tehama County is experiencing gradual growth due to its location along Interstate 5, connecting it to larger markets like Sacramento and Redding. According to the Tehama County Economic Development Corporation, infrastructure improvements and business incentives are attracting new residents and investors, potentially increasing property values over time.
- Quality of Life: Tehama County offers a slower pace of life with less traffic and congestion compared to urban areas. The county’s schools, such as those in the Red Bluff Union Elementary School District, are known for smaller class sizes and community involvement, making it a great place for families.

Additional Considerations for Tehama County Homebuyers
Beyond the basics of securing a purchase loan, there are specific factors to consider when buying a home in Tehama County. For instance, the county’s rural nature means some areas may qualify for USDA loans, which can be a game-changer for buyers with limited down payment funds. Additionally, seasonal weather patterns, including hot summers and potential wildfire risks in certain areas, should be factored into your home selection and insurance planning. Furthermore, Tehama County’s housing inventory often includes a mix of historic Victorian homes in Red Bluff, modern builds in developing areas, and expansive rural properties ideal for farming or privacy. According to Zillow data for 2023, the average time on market for homes in Tehama County is around 60-70 days, slightly longer than urban markets, giving buyers more time to evaluate options and negotiate.
